    A lotta movie making going on here

    Matt Brouska's post made me aware of just how much filming is going on here in Nova Scotia. Two hot one's will be THE SHIPPING NEWS, starring Kevin Spacey and Judy Dench. Some of the scenes were shot at The Halifax Herald, a daily newspaper where I got my start in the publishing business.

    The other big movie, which will probably be a blockbuster, stars Harrison Ford and Liam Neeson and I believe it's called THE WIDOW MAKER, or something like that. It's about a Russian submarine and something that happens to it that's supposed to be a true story. A lot of the movie was shot at The Halifax Shipyards which was redecorated to look like a shipyard in Russia. The submarine, the real star of the movie, was towed here and a lot of the shots at sea were filmed just outside Halifax Harbour.

    There's another film being shot starring Mira Sorvino (love to get a look at her in person) and Mariah Carey here in Halifax, but the title escapes me at the moment.

    Another was shot recently starring Sean Penn and Elizabeth Hurley.

    They're starting to call Nova Scotia the Hollywood of Canada. I don't know if that's good or bad, I only know I'll definitely be watching for these films when they're released.
